Modern MBA covers business topics through Wall Street case studies on the Fortune 500 and everyday industries. Content titles suggest deep-dives into profitability and business models across retail, food & beverage, experiences, and entertainment, with tutorials-style exploration of how different sectors make money. What type of content does Modern MBA make?

Modern MBA creates explainer-style videos about business topics, as evidenced by titles like The Secret Business of Nightclubs, The Evolving Business of Donuts, The Territorial Business of Tacos, The Shrinking Business of Sneakers, and How Boba Shops Really Make Money.
